376/**
377 * i2c_add_adapter - declare i2c adapter, use dynamic bus number
378 * @adapter: the adapter to add
379 *
380 * This routine is used to declare an I2C adapter when its bus number
381 * doesn't matter. Examples: for I2C adapters dynamically added by
382 * USB links or PCI plugin cards.
383 *
384 * When this returns zero, a new bus number was allocated and stored
385 * in adap->nr, and the specified adapter became available for clients.
386 * Otherwise, a negative errno value is returned.
387 */
388int i2c_add_adapter(struct i2c_adapter *adapter)
389{
390 int id, res = 0;
391
392retry:
393 if (idr_pre_get(&i2c_adapter_idr, GFP_KERNEL) == 0)
394 return -ENOMEM;
395
396 mutex_lock(&core_lists);
397 /* "above" here means "above or equal to", sigh */
398 res = idr_get_new_above(&i2c_adapter_idr, adapter,
399 __i2c_first_dynamic_bus_num, &id);
400 mutex_unlock(&core_lists);
401
402 if (res < 0) {
403 if (res == -EAGAIN)
404 goto retry;
405 return res;
406 }
407
408 adapter->nr = id;
409 return i2c_register_adapter(adapter);
410}
411EXPORT_SYMBOL(i2c_add_adapter);

413/**
414 * i2c_add_numbered_adapter - declare i2c adapter, use static bus number
415 * @adap: the adapter to register (with adap->nr initialized)
416 *
417 * This routine is used to declare an I2C adapter when its bus number
418 * matters. Example: for I2C adapters from system-on-chip CPUs, or
419 * otherwise built in to the system's mainboard, and where i2c_board_info
420 * is used to properly configure I2C devices.
421 *
422 * If no devices have pre-been declared for this bus, then be sure to
423 * register the adapter before any dynamically allocated ones. Otherwise
424 * the required bus ID may not be available.
425 *
426 * When this returns zero, the specified adapter became available for
427 * clients using the bus number provided in adap->nr. Also, the table
428 * of I2C devices pre-declared using i2c_register_board_info() is scanned,
429 * and the appropriate driver model device nodes are created. Otherwise, a
430 * negative errno value is returned.
431 */
432int i2c_add_numbered_adapter(struct i2c_adapter *adap)
433{
434 int id;
435 int status;
436
437 if (adap->nr & ~MAX_ID_MASK)
438 return -EINVAL;
439
440retry:
441 if (idr_pre_get(&i2c_adapter_idr, GFP_KERNEL) == 0)
442 return -ENOMEM;
443
444 mutex_lock(&core_lists);
445 /* "above" here means "above or equal to", sigh;
446 * we need the "equal to" result to force the result
447 */
448 status = idr_get_new_above(&i2c_adapter_idr, adap, adap->nr, &id);
449 if (status == 0 && id != adap->nr) {
450 status = -EBUSY;
451 idr_remove(&i2c_adapter_idr, id);
452 }
453 mutex_unlock(&core_lists);
454 if (status == -EAGAIN)
455 goto retry;
456
457 if (status == 0)
458 status = i2c_register_adapter(adap);
459 return status;
460}
461E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(i2c_add_numbered_adapter);
